It just went silent on me.
I've never had any problem with my beloved '94 until last Sunday. Started right up like it has everyday for the last 3 yrs ...moved it across the street, so I could pull a trail up to the house. When I went to start it up to move it back ...I heard nothing but silence. The lights on the gauge cluster went out as soon as I hit the start button. It didn't come back on until about 20 minutes later. Hit the start again with the same result.
I tested the battery and it is at 10.44 volts. So plenty of juice in the box. When the lights came on for me today I ran it down the street and jumped the clutch. It fired right up and ran like the fine tuned monster machine it is. I shut her off and then tried to start her back up, and nothing but silence.
I'm thinking it could be the starter but would that cause the lost of juice coming from the battery? When I turn the key with the tester on the battery, It loses all power and drops to .003-.005.
Any idea's fzrians. I gotta get this baby back up and running right away. It's bad enough I can ride it right now, but DelMarVa Bike Week is in a couple weeks.
